Responsibilities:
- Utilise your expertise in underwriting within the context of Islamic insurance to evaluate insurance applications, assess risks, and determine appropriate coverage.
- Conduct thorough analysis of policy documents, ensuring accuracy and completeness of information.
- Collaborate with team members to ensure consistent underwriting decisions and maintain a high level of quality.
- Provide exceptional customer service to internal and external stakeholders, addressing inquiries and resolving underwriting-related issues.
- Demonstrate proficiency in evaluating and handling complex claims, ensuring timely and accurate resolution within the framework of Islamic principles.
- Stay up-to-date on industry trends, regulations, and best practices in underwriting, continuously improving your knowledge and skills.
- Contribute to the development and enhancement of underwriting guidelines and procedures to optimize efficiency and effectiveness.
- Participate in departmental meetings and training sessions, sharing knowledge, insights, and contributing to the success of the underwriting team.
- Collaborate with other departments, such as sales and risk management, to support business objectives and deliver comprehensive insurance solutions.
- Train, manage, and mentor junior team members and graduates, leveraging your experience to support their growth and development within the organization.
Requirements:
- Minimum of 5 years of experience in underwriting within the insurance industry.
- Bachelor's degree in a relevant field, preferably in Insurance, Risk Management, or a related discipline.
- RE qualified.
-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, with the ability to effectively interact with diverse stakeholders.
- Detail-oriented mindset with strong analytical and problem-solving abilities.
- Self-motivated and able to work independently, as well as contribute effectively in a team environment.
- Proficiency in MS Office Suite, including Word, Excel, and Outlook.
